Supported by geographically diverse, redundant servers and storage maintained and upgraded by MinuteHound IT, the only requirements for customer use are purchase of one or more $99 USB fingerprint scanners which install and operate in the background on an Internet-connected PC from desktop to laptop or thin client. Installation is quick and easy, with MinuteHound providing direct telephone support if needed.
Accumulated time and attendance data is recorded in simple and secure records containing a one-way encoded fingerprint key and Internet-based timestamp. Server software provides Web-based access to data in aggregate or individual form through a drill-down interface as well as programmed alerts at the workforce or individual level, tracking manpower availability and employee tardiness as needed.

From paper time cards involving corrections, errors, and occasional inaccuracies resulting from time clock errors or "buddy punching," or the hassle and similar issues of electronic time clocks, employees will simply scan a finger and continue to their jobs. MinuteHound's patented one-way fingerprint encryption method and redundant storage means data and employee privacy are protected.
In the payroll department, not only will the company save significant time by not having to regularly verify and correct data thanks to MinuteHound's highly accurate scanning, but data is available for download in a variety of formats. It's ready to integrate with most online and corporate payroll systems. Even before payroll is run, managers will have aggregate and individual time data in real time, accessible over the Internet from anywhere in the world.
